About the Company
Founded | Employees | CEO | Website |
---|---|---|---|
1971 | 1,500 | Thierry Andretta | https://www.mulberry.com |
Mulberry Group plc, through its subsidiaries, designs and manufactures fashion accessories and clothing in the United Kingdom, Asia Pacific, and internationally. It provides briefcases, messenger bags, and backpacks; wallets, and purses and pouches; sunglasses, scarves, gloves and hats, belts, cufflinks, keyrings, and shoes; jewelry, organisers, leather care, and care products; gifts; and luggage, holdalls, bag, and other travel accessories for men and women, as well as ready-to-wear and eyewear products. The company sells its products through its retail shops, concessions, and wholesale distribution channels under the Mulberry brand, as well as sells its products online.
